新闻中心

Excel如何使用INDIRECT函数动态引用_INDIRECT函数操作方法

2025-12-13
浏览次数:
返回列表
INDIRECT函数可将文本字符串转换为单元格引用,支持动态构建地址、跨表调用、名称管理器联动及错误处理;其语法为=INDIRECT(ref_text,[a1]),常配合&拼接、IFERROR容错使用。

excel如何使用indirect函数动态引用_indirect函数操作方法

如果您希望在Excel中根据单元格内容动态构建并引用其他单元格或区域地址,则INDIRECT函数是实现该目标的核心工具。以下是具体操作方法:

一、理解INDIRECT函数的基本语法与作用

INDIRECT函数将文本字符串解释为单元格引用,从而实现“文本转引用”的功能。它不直接计算数值,而是依据输入的字符串定位真实单元格,适用于构建可变引用、跨表调用及下拉联动等场景。

1、函数基本格式为:=INDIRECT(ref_text, [a1]),其中ref_text为必填项,表示以文本形式存在的单元格地址或命名区域;a1为可选逻辑值,TRUE表示A1样式引用,FALSE表示R1C1样式引用。

2、若ref_text内容为"Sheet2!B5",则INDIRECT("Sheet2!B5")返回Sheet2工作表中B5单元格的实际值。

3、当ref_text本身由其他函数拼接生成(如A1&"!"&B1)时,INDIRECT可实现地址的动态组装与即时解析。

二、通过单元格内容构建引用地址

该方法适用于引用地址存储在某个单元格中,需将其内容作为实际引用路径使用的情形。INDIRECT会读取该单元格的文本值,并按其内容定位目标单元格。

1、在A1单元格中输入文本:B2

2、在C1单元格中输入公式:=INDIRECT(A1)

3、此时C1将显示B2单元格的值;若修改A1为"D10",C1将自动更新为D10单元格的值。

三、拼接字符串生成跨工作表引用

利用&运算符连接工作表名与单元格地址,形成完整引用路径文本,再交由INDIRECT解析,可实现对不同工作表中固定位置单元格的动态调用。

1、在A1单元格中输入工作表名称:销售部(确保该工作表已存在)。

2、在B1单元格中输入目标单元格地址:C5

动态WEB网站中的PHP和MySQL:直观的QuickPro指南第2版 动态WEB网站中的PHP和MySQL:直观的QuickPro指南第2版

动态WEB网站中的PHP和MySQL详细反映实际程序的需求,仔细地探讨外部数据的验证(例如信用卡卡号的格式)、用户登录以及如何使用模板建立网页的标准外观。动态WEB网站中的PHP和MySQL的内容不仅仅是这些。书中还提到如何串联J*aScript与PHP让用户操作时更快、更方便。还有正确处理用户输入错误的方法,让网站看起来更专业。另外还引入大量来自PEAR*函数库的强大功能,对常用的、强大的包

动态WEB网站中的PHP和MySQL:直观的QuickPro指南第2版 525 查看详情 动态WEB网站中的PHP和MySQL:直观的QuickPro指南第2版

3、在C1单元格中输入公式:=INDIRECT("'"&A1&"'!"&B1),注意单引号用于包裹含空格或特殊字符的工作表名。

4、公式将组合为'销售部!C5并返回该单元格内容。

四、结合名称管理器创建动态区域引用

预先在名称管理器中定义基于公式的动态区域名称,再通过INDIRECT调用该名称,可实现对变动范围(如新增数据行)的自动适配引用。

1、选中【公式】选项卡,点击【名称管理器】→【新建】。

2、在“名称”栏输入:动态销售额;在“引用位置”栏输入:=OFFSET(销售表!$B$2,0,0,COUNTA(销售表!$B:$B)-1,1)(假设数据从B2开始连续填充)。

3、在任意单元格中输入:=SUM(INDIRECT("动态销售额")),即可对当前所有非空销售额求和。

五、处理引用失效时的容错控制

当INDIRECT引用的目标地址不存在、工作表被删除或拼接错误时,函数将返回#REF!错误。可通过IFERROR包裹INDIRECT,提供备用值或提示信息。

1、在A1中输入可能无效的地址:Sheet99!A1

2、在B1中输入公式:=IFERROR(INDIRECT(A1),"未找到对应工作表")

3、若Sheet99不存在,B1将显示“未找到对应工作表”,而非错误值。

以上就是Excel如何使用INDIRECT函数动态引用_INDIRECT函数操作方法的详细内容,更多请关注其它相关文章!


# 将其  # 江西医疗器械网站建设  # 仁寿网站优化  # 咸阳网站建设  # 芯烨网站建设  # 太原seo方法  # 百度推广网站留言  # 成都抖音搜索seo技巧  # 柏乡网站建设列表  # 辽宁网站推广有什么方法  # 海安智能网站推广服务商  # excel  # 如果您  # 未找到  # 不存在  # 运算符  # 适用于  # 管理器  # 操作方法  # 如何使用  # 单元格  # 工具 


相关栏目: 【 科技资讯46185 】 【 网络学院92790


相关推荐: 如何在更新Composer依赖后自动运行测试_使用post-update-cmd钩子触发PHPUnit  Win11怎么设置鼠标指针速度_Win11提高鼠标指针精确度选项  QQ邮箱登录官网首页 腾讯QQ邮箱网页入口  163邮箱登录密码 163邮箱忘记密码找回  C++如何打印当前代码行号与文件名_C++预定义宏FILE与LINE的使用  J*aScript生成器_j*ascript异步迭代  React列表渲染与独立状态管理:避免全局状态影响局部更新  Win10系统怎么查看已安装更新_Win10卸载有问题的更新补丁  html怎么在cmd下运行php文件_cmd运行html中php文件方法【教程】  解决Python logging 中 datefmt 导致时间戳固定不变的问题  马斯克:Optimus 人形机器人复数形式为 Optimi  AO3最新可访问网址 Archive of Our Own官方在线入口  c++中的std::basic_string的SSO优化_c++短字符串优化深度解析  多闪网页版在线观看免费入口_多闪官网访问入口  win11开机启动修复循环怎么办 Win11无法进入系统高级启动解决方法【修复】  响应式图片在网页设计中的正确实现方法  蛙漫官方正版入口 蛙漫网页在线全集免费观看  微博网页版主页入口 微博官方网站免登录访问  特斯拉自动驾驶房车计划曝光 原型车将于2027年亮相  批改网学生版PC登录 批改网官网登录系统入口  PySpark中高效提取字符串右侧可变长度数字:使用regexp_extract  Flexbox布局实践:实现粘性导航栏与底部固定页脚  uc手机浏览器网页版入口 uc浏览器手机版便捷登录首页  c++如何实现一个简单的ECS框架_c++数据驱动设计与游戏开发  抓大鹅无需下载版 抓大鹅秒玩版入口  J*aScript中正确使用querySelectorAll与复杂CSS选择器  “在文档元素之后找到了标记”是什么错误? 检查并修复XML中多个根元素的3个方法  Angular中父组件异步更新子组件复选框状态的实践指南  黑鲨3Pro怎样在相册开漫画风滤镜_iPhone黑鲨3Pro相册开漫画风滤镜【趣味滤镜】  如何有效阻止外部脚本意外修改内联样式的高度属性  在Pyomo中实现基于变量的条件约束:Big-M方法详解  J*a如何使用AtomicInteger控制计数_J*a无锁计数器性能分析  Mac终端命令大全_Mac常用Terminal指令速查  ArchiveofOurOwn小说阅读-ArchiveofOurOwn同人作品访问链接  c++如何使用std::memory_order控制原子操作顺序_c++ C++11内存模型详解  俄罗斯浏览器官网直达链接 俄罗斯浏览器最新在线入口导航  如何使用Go和Martini动态服务解码后的图片  Python字典中优雅地迭代剩余元素的方法  Basecamp怎样用留言钉固定重点_Basecamp用留言钉固定重点【重点标记】  高德地图沿途添加点失败如何解决 高德多点规划方法  漫蛙manwa官网登录界面_漫蛙漫画网页版主站入口  C++如何连接MySQL数据库_C++使用Connector/C++操作MySQL数据库教程  想当下一个《2077》?《心之眼》Steam评价升至"多半好评"  sublime如何配置Python开发环境_将sublime打造成轻量级Python IDE  微信怎么把收藏的内容分类管理 微信收藏内容标签分类方法  在VS Code中配置和运行Dart程序的完整步骤  Go语言中高效处理x-www-form-urlencoded表单数据  汽水音乐网页版使用入口_汽水音乐电脑版播放指南  Composer如何解决json扩展缺失的错误  利用5118提升短视频内容效果_5118短视频关键词优化方法 

搜索